Step 2: Choose Between DIY or Professional Production
Now that you are committed to creating an audiobook, the next big question is: Should you do it yourself or hire professionals? Both routes have pros and cons, and your decision will depend on your budget, timeline and personal preferences.
DIY Production
If you are on a tight budget and confident in your voice, DIY production might be worth exploring. You will need access to high-quality recording equipment, soundproofing materials and audio editing software. It is also critical to have a quiet space where you can record consistently without interruptions.
However, DIY doesn’t always mean free. Between equipment, editing software and the time investment, costs can still add up. And if you're not trained in voice acting or sound engineering, your final product may fall short of professional standards.

Step 3: Prepare Your Manuscript for Audio
You might think your book is ready as-is, but hold on, there are a few adjustments you will want to make before recording begins. Converting a written manuscript into an audiobook requires a slightly different mindset.
Clean Up the Text
Start by reviewing your manuscript. Make sure it is free from typos, awkward sentence structures or text that might not translate well when spoken aloud. Remember, what reads well in print may sound clunky in audio. Proofreading is essential and professional editing services can help fine-tune your manuscript for the spoken word.
Add Audio-Friendly Cues
Consider how certain elements like footnotes, graphs or tables will be handled in audio form. You may need to rewrite these parts or remove them entirely. Some authors also include a special intro or outro just for audio listeners, such as a personal thank-you message or bonus commentary.

Step 5: Record, Edit, and Master the Audio
This is where your audiobook starts to take shape. Whether you are recording on your own or working with a professional studio, the process typically involves:
Recording Sessions
Each chapter is recorded separately, often multiple times, to ensure clean takes. If you are hiring a narrator, they will handle this with studio support. If you are doing it yourself, be prepared to spend hours in front of a mic and do not forget to hydrate!
Editing and Proofing
After recording, the audio is edited to remove errors, background noise and pauses. Timing is synced and the audio is proofed to ensure it matches the manuscript. This step is crucial because any inconsistency can confuse listeners or lead to a rejected file from distributors.
Mastering
Finally, the files are mastered. This involves adjusting levels, ensuring consistent volume and formatting the files to meet the technical standards of platforms like Audible and Apple Books.
